Mountain Center for Recovery and Hope is a drug and alcohol rehab for individuals living in the Jackhorn, KY. area while battling a substance abuse disorder and co-occurring mental health disorder. It offers services like cognitive/behavior therapy, matrix model, dual diagnosis drug rehab, couple/family therapy, relapse prevention, vocational rehabilitation services and more, that are in line with its philosophy of the treatments that have been proved to work.
Mountain Center for Recovery and Hope believes in individual treatment to make sure that their patients find success and sobriety. The addiction treatment program has also specialized in other types of care like aftercare/continuing care, housing services, social skills development, co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ders, suicide prevention services, treatment for spanish-speaking clients - among many others. Many of these services are also provided by Mountain Center for Recovery and Hope in different settings like long term treatment programs, inpatient treatment programs, detox centers, short term drug treatment, outpatient day treatment, as well as others.
Further, it has aftercare programs designed to help you achieve permanent and lasting sobriety. These programs have ensured that Mountain Center for Recovery and Hope has a special place within Jackhorn, Kentucky and its surrounding area, especially because they promote both positive short and long term outcomes for the clients who enroll into this alcohol and drug treatment facility. Last but not least, Mountain Center for Recovery and Hope accepts private health insurance, private pay, sliding fee scale, payment assistance, other state funds, access to recovery (atr) voucher and others.
